Melt Gelato & Crepe Cafe  

Categories: Creperies, Desserts, Ice Cream & Frozen Yogurt
Neighborhood: Torrance

5 star rating
 6/22/2009  
I didn't try the crepes, but the gelato was pretty freakin good.  Maybe not totally authentic, but the flavors I had were fresh and natural tasting.  My husband also liked that when he asked for a couple cups of water they weren't pissy about it, and the water was ice cold.  

I had a medium cup of the taste of italy, which was amaretto with chocolate chunks and key lime.  The taste of Italy was scrumptious - lots of amaretto against bittersweet chocolate makes me very happy.  The key lime was also phenomenal - tart and with lots of graham crackers crushed in to give it a substantial, almost gritty mouthfeel.  I tasted my mother-in-laws rum raisin (a flavor I don't usually go for), but it was delicious and reminded me of Christmas.  I'm usually pretty picky about gelato but Melt impressed me.

Dry Soda  

Category: Specialty Food
Neighborhood: Pioneer Square

5 star rating
 6/17/2009  
This review is just for the soda...I haven't been to the tasting room.  I picked up a four pack at Henry's last week and got one of each flavor (lavender, kumquat, rhubarb and lemongrass).  As everyone else here has said, they are lightly sweet, almost more like a sparking water with an essence of flavor, but so sophisticated and with tiny bubbles.  I enjoyed the lemongrass with Greek food and then the kumquat with pasta.  I haven't figured out what to have the other 2 with yet...

Their website is awesome and I learned that the sodas were created by a woman who was pregnant and looking for something to pair with food when she couldn't drink wine (which is exactly the reason I bought them too!)  It's so nice to have something elegant and tasty to drink with dinner that's also not bad for the baby because it's not loaded with corn syrup like other sodas.

Beautiful design, thoughtful, unique flavors and a great female-owned Seattle-based company.  I think I've found a new thing to crave!

Strickland's Ice Cream  

Category: Ice Cream & Frozen Yogurt

5 star rating
 6/15/2009  
All I can say is it's a damn good thing this place wasn't around when I went to UCI.  The "freshman 15" may have turned into something scarier.  I used to live right across the street from this shopping center and worked at the Starbucks on the other end of the parking lot.  Considering that back then we had to drive down to the Newport Dairy Queen for a decent frozen treat, a place like this was long overdue.

I had the pistachio and mud pie and my husband had a dole whip.  I was skeptical about that one, because I love Tiki Room version and have such fond memories, but this hit it spot on.  And the swirl of pineapple with strawberry - ingenious!  My ice cream was delicious as well...creamy, sweet and with flavors that tasted natural.  

Oh and from someone with an ice cream maker and a culinary degree let me just say that ice cream *is* frozen custard.  Making that distinction is like calling ice "frozen water."  But then, if it sells more cones, good for them!
